The best time to visit versova Beach is during the ganpati visarjan Thousands of revelers come to see the beautiful images of lord Ganesh being taken out to the sea, for bidding farewell to the elephant God whom they prayed to for the full ten days. Not only are the images but even worth seeing the groups of koli women who are dressed in their Sunday best. They come dancing to the popular tunes played by the local bands; these women are all dressed alike in same saris and jewellary. During the visarjan which starts at 5’oclock in the evening to the next day in the morning the whole beach is illuminated with flood lights and it looks like a fairy land, the sea is full of gaily decorated boats and launches which wait for the Lord to arrive to submerge Him into the sea, these boats and launches take the revelers and the images of God in the middle of the sea for visarjan.The visarjan is done in the middle of the sea exactly at the point just opposite the Shiva temple at madh island. With the music of drums and cymbals and the resounding sound of Ganpati bapa moriya. Around 300 Ganpati idols of various sizes are immersed here; these idols are immersed throughout the day. The fishermen do not go out to sea for catching fish for three days because of the visarjan of their favorite God. They have at least 40 people working around the clock for the visarjan and the boats and launches are given free of charge for the visarjan of the Ganesh idols
